Who is an ERP Implementation Engineer?
An ERP (Enterprise Resource Planning) Implementation Engineer is a crucial player in modern business operations. They are the professionals responsible for deploying, configuring, and customizing ERP systems to meet the specific needs of an organization. Think of them as the architects and builders of a company's central nervous system – the ERP system. They work closely with various departments, from finance and HR to supply chain and manufacturing, to ensure the ERP system integrates seamlessly and efficiently.
Key Responsibilities:
- Planning and Design: Understanding business requirements and designing the ERP implementation strategy.
- Configuration and Customization: Tailoring the ERP system to fit the organization's unique processes.
- Data Migration: Transferring existing data from legacy systems to the new ERP system.
- Testing and Training: Ensuring the system works correctly and training users on how to use it effectively.
- Troubleshooting and Support: Resolving issues and providing ongoing support to users.
Skills Required:
- Strong understanding of ERP systems (SAP, Oracle, Microsoft Dynamics, etc.)
- Technical skills in database management, programming, and system administration.
- Excellent communication and interpersonal skills.
- Problem-solving and analytical abilities.
- Project management skills.
What Does an ERP Implementation Engineer Do?
The role of an ERP Implementation Engineer is multifaceted, involving a blend of technical expertise, project management, and communication skills. Their primary goal is to ensure the successful deployment and ongoing operation of an ERP system. Here's a breakdown of their key responsibilities:
- Requirement Gathering: Working with stakeholders to understand their business needs and translate them into ERP system requirements.
- System Configuration: Configuring the ERP system modules (finance, HR, supply chain, etc.) to align with business processes.
- Customization: Developing custom solutions or modifications to the ERP system to address unique business requirements.
- Data Migration: Planning and executing the migration of data from legacy systems to the ERP system, ensuring data integrity and accuracy.
- Testing: Conducting thorough testing of the ERP system to identify and resolve any issues or bugs.
- Training: Developing and delivering training programs to users on how to effectively use the ERP system.
- Go-Live Support: Providing support during the initial rollout of the ERP system to ensure a smooth transition.
- Ongoing Maintenance and Support: Providing ongoing maintenance, troubleshooting, and support to users after the ERP system is live.
Tools and Technologies:
- ERP Systems (SAP, Oracle, Microsoft Dynamics, etc.)
- Database Management Systems (SQL Server, Oracle, MySQL)
- Programming Languages (ABAP, Java, .NET)
- Project Management Software (Jira, Asana)
How to Become an ERP Implementation Engineer in India?
Becoming an ERP Implementation Engineer in India requires a combination of education, technical skills, and practical experience. Here's a step-by-step guide:
-
Education:
- Bachelor's Degree: Obtain a bachelor's degree in computer science, information technology, engineering, or a related field. A strong foundation in IT principles is essential.
- Master's Degree (Optional): A master's degree in a relevant field can provide a competitive edge and deeper knowledge.
-
Technical Skills:
- ERP System Knowledge: Gain expertise in one or more ERP systems (SAP, Oracle, Microsoft Dynamics). Consider taking certification courses offered by these vendors.
- Database Management: Develop skills in database management systems like SQL Server, Oracle, or MySQL.
- Programming: Learn programming languages relevant to ERP systems, such as ABAP (for SAP), Java, or .NET.
- System Administration: Acquire knowledge of system administration principles and practices.
-
Experience:
- Internships: Seek internships with companies that use ERP systems or with ERP implementation partners.
- Entry-Level Positions: Start with entry-level positions such as ERP support specialist, junior developer, or business analyst.
- ERP Implementation Projects: Actively participate in ERP implementation projects to gain hands-on experience.
-
Certifications:
- ERP Vendor Certifications: Obtain certifications from ERP vendors (SAP, Oracle, Microsoft) to demonstrate your expertise.
-
Soft Skills:
- Communication: Develop strong communication and interpersonal skills to effectively interact with stakeholders.
- Problem-Solving: Enhance your problem-solving and analytical abilities to troubleshoot issues and find solutions.
- Project Management: Acquire project management skills to manage ERP implementation projects effectively.
Key Considerations for Indian Students:
- Focus on in-demand ERP systems: Research which ERP systems are most widely used in the Indian market.
- Network: Attend industry events and connect with professionals in the ERP field.
- Stay updated: Keep abreast of the latest trends and technologies in the ERP space.
History and Evolution of ERP Systems and the ERP Implementation Engineer Role
The history of ERP systems is closely tied to the evolution of business computing. In the early days, businesses relied on disparate systems to manage different functions, such as accounting, manufacturing, and inventory. This led to inefficiencies and data silos.
- 1960s & 70s: The Dawn of MRP: The precursor to ERP was Material Requirements Planning (MRP), which focused on managing inventory and production scheduling. These systems were primarily used in manufacturing.
- 1980s: MRP II Emerges: MRP evolved into Manufacturing Resource Planning (MRP II), which expanded to include other functions like finance and human resources. This marked the beginning of integrated business systems.
- 1990s: The Birth of ERP: ERP systems emerged as a comprehensive solution that integrated all aspects of a business, from finance and HR to supply chain and customer relationship management. Key players like SAP and Oracle rose to prominence.
- 2000s: Web-Based ERP and Cloud Adoption: The rise of the internet led to web-based ERP systems, making them more accessible and affordable. Cloud-based ERP solutions also began to gain traction.
- Present: AI and Machine Learning in ERP: Today, ERP systems are incorporating artificial intelligence (AI) and machine learning (ML) to automate tasks, improve decision-making, and enhance user experience.
Evolution of the ERP Implementation Engineer Role:
As ERP systems have become more complex, the role of the ERP Implementation Engineer has also evolved. Initially, these professionals were primarily focused on technical tasks like system configuration and data migration. However, today's ERP Implementation Engineers need a broader range of skills, including:
- Business Process Understanding: A deep understanding of business processes and how ERP systems can support them.
- Change Management: The ability to manage organizational change and ensure user adoption of the ERP system.
- Project Management: Strong project management skills to plan and execute ERP implementation projects effectively.
- Consulting Skills: The ability to advise clients on best practices and help them optimize their ERP systems.
The future of the ERP Implementation Engineer role will likely involve even greater emphasis on AI, cloud computing, and data analytics. These professionals will need to stay updated with the latest technologies and trends to remain competitive.
